自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

根据自定类型,采用JAVASCRIPT方便进行数据完整性验证,所有页面都可以通用

页面输入完整性是编写BS经常遇到的问题,如果那里需要就到那里写,那可是要花不少的时候,并且造成不必要的浪费,下面是一个通过校验脚本,使用非常方便,通过传入FORM名就可以进行校验,通过在页面控件中增加用户本身自定义属性,进行方便的验证,包括数字的输入、密码的输入、EMAIL的输入,用户本身可以进行无限的扩展,使用如下,在页面中加入如下代码:<formname="form1"&g...

2008-07-31 23:44:00 98

对一个可进行带括号、加减乘除运算类的分析

源程序来源于:http://bbs.tarena.com.cn/viewthread.php?tid=102826&extra=&page=1这里主要对该程序的运行进行基本的分析,搞清楚其原理。因为我本人原来在参加面试的时候遇到过这样的问题,当时就没有答上来,有点后悔,所有这里补补。这个程序主要采用的是将数进行压栈的方式,我们知道栈的方式是先进后出,一直遇到当前阶段优先级最...

2008-07-31 14:50:00 228

JAVA内部类示例分析

内部类是非常有用的类,如果该内部类只为当前类服务,写成内部类将是非常好的选择,详细看程序中的注释:import java.util.HashMap;public class Test1 { //声明一个存储"指令"的HashMap,根据"指令"存取不同的值 private static HashMap hashMap=new HashMap(); //声明一个静态内部类,并在内部...

2008-07-31 13:27:00 55

接口和抽象类有什么区别

接口和抽象类有什么区别 你选择使用接口和抽象类的依据是什么? 接口和抽象类的概念不一样。接口是对动作的抽象,抽象类是对根源的抽象。抽象类表示的是,这个对象是什么。接口表示的是,这个对象能做什么。比如,男人,女人,这两个类(如果是类的话……),他们的抽象类是人。说明,他们都是人。人可以吃东西,狗也可以吃东西,你可以把“吃东西”定义成一个接口,然后让这些类去实现它.所以,在高级语言...

2008-07-31 12:54:00 164

金额与数字转化常用实用几个JS方法

财务系统中常用到金额与数字转化的处理,这里包括以下几个方法:1、去空格2、页面控件的金额与数字之间的转换3、一般金额与数字之间的转换4、将数字金额转化为汉字金额。//在引用页面,可以采用document.forms[0].field1.value.trim()引用去空格String.prototype.trim = function(){ return this.replace(/...

2008-07-29 13:12:00 102

Sybase中使用JAVA函数

在SYBASE12.5或者更久以前的版本都是不支持函数,但是有些时候我们又需要一些函数,而不仅仅是过程,这里有可以采用JAVA实现,并且写JAVA肯定比写存储过程要好多了,JAVA处理数据的能力或者是类型,会让SYBASE增不少光彩。以下是网上找到的一篇文章,详细介绍如何在SYBASE中使用JAVA,但我先说明一点,我现在用的是12.5.4这个版本,也提示开启JAVA功能成功,但是去不能够将JAR...

2008-07-29 12:28:00 142

采用审计数据库监视数据库的更改

有些时候我们需要知道数据表做了什么样的更改,写入了什么样的语句,这个时候可以采用审计数据库来做这个工作,用以记录需要的信息,但是配置过程有点烦,下面是一篇CHINAUNIX上面的文章,说如何配置审计数据库:http://bbs.chinaunix.net/archiver/?tid-560903.html...

2008-07-26 19:58:00 98

SYBASE中生成所有建表语句的过程

--经常在用,感觉还不错。在数据移植的时候,配上BCP,那可是非常的方便if exists(select 1 from sysobjects where name = 'sp_gent' and type = 'P') drop procedure sp_gentgocreate procedure sp_gent @tblname varchar(30) = null, ...

2008-07-24 20:13:00 87

Sybase中字符串替换函数:STR_REPLACE

用法:SELECT STR_REPLACE("abc99922defg121212hicde","a","")不过,好像不支持正则表达式,如下则得不到想要的结果:去掉所有非数字字符:SELECT STR_REPLACE("abc99922defg121212hicde","[^0-9]","")不过,有也不错了,前面一直找,还以为没有。...

2008-07-24 19:47:00 335

在JS中使用trim()方法

在调用trim()的JS方法上面加入如下JS代码:String.prototype.trim = function(){ return this.replace(/(^\s*)|(\s*$)/g, "");}就可以像JAVA中使用trim()方法了:if(document.forms[0].aa.value.trim()==""){}...

2008-07-24 19:22:00 73

不同数据库移植移植方法一、二

当我们把有些应用写到存储过程中,或者是调用与系统相关的函数,此时想把当前系统移值到其它的数据库上,这个往往是非常头痛的问题,因为不同的系统支持不同的存储过程,如ORACLE和SYBASE。1、采用中间对照表。将SYBASE中常用的函数与ORACLE中相对的函数相对应,如果有的那是肯定非常好,都不用更改了,如果两个要实现相同功能的函数名称却不相同的时候,如SYBASE中的ISNULL函数,而OR...

2008-07-22 13:00:00 123

java与c/c++进行socket通信的一些问题

文章来源:http://blog.csdn.net/kingfish/archive/2005/03/29/333635.aspx 近几天看到csdn上问c/c++和java通信的问题比较多,特别是c特有的数据结构(如struct)。特地根据网友的一个问题举个例子,希望对初学者有所帮助。原问题见:http://community.csdn.net/Expert/topic/3886/3...

2008-07-21 15:58:00 125

csdn的博客

不好意思,现在貌似可以了,呵呵,某些情况下,js还是不够可靠,特别是不通的浏览器,以及装了一些ie插件的情况下,影响比较大。希望能增加一个简洁版的发表文章的窗口,大部分时候,我不需要用这些东西。一般我都在下面调整好格式粘贴上来的,在线编辑,很不可靠,有时候写了一大堆,提交出错了(网络断了等等),数据就全部丢失了,那个精神损失是很大的。...

2008-07-21 15:12:00 85

AJAX提交数据时的中文处理

06年时,就开始用AJAX技术了,当时这个名词还没兴起,后来听说AJAX,才发现原来还有这个叫法。早期,相关资料相当少,中文问题非常头疼,直到现在,网上也没有一个很好的解决方式。最近,了解到一些朋友又深陷其中,便把自己以前的解决方法拿出来晒晒,希望对误入该行业的朋友有些帮助。原理:html不能设置编码,但是xml可以,我们采用xml,把数据携带过去,不就可以了嘛。js核心代码:...

2008-07-21 13:46:00 100

java zip 中文问题

用ant解压包含中文文件名的压缩文件 中文问题是java中的普遍性问题.今天下午遇到一个包含中文文件名的压缩文件解压问题.找了不少资料.现贴出解集.在java.util.zip包也可以用来处理解压问题,不过对含有中文文件名的压缩包无能为力,这是因为ZipOutputStream压缩和解压ZIP文件对文件名都是以UTF-8编码方式来处理的,而我们用winzip压缩文件对文件名只会以ASCII编码方式...

2008-07-15 11:26:00 72

Java中压缩与解压--中文文件名乱码解决办法

java对於文字的编码是以 unicode为基础,因此,若是以ZipInputStream及ZipOutputStream来处理压缩及解压缩的工作,碰到中文档名或路径,那当然是以unicode来处理罗!但是,现在市面上的压缩及解压缩软体,例如winzip,却是不支援unicode的,一碰到档名以unicode编码的档案,它就不处理。 那要如何才能做出让WinRar能够处理的压缩档呢?那就得从修改Z...

2008-07-15 11:19:00 81

对当前目录下所有文件进行压缩代码

import java.io.*;import java.util.zip.*;public class Test{ static final int BUFFER = 2048; public static String ChangeName(String s) { int j = 0; String newstring = ""; for (int i=0; i<s.lengt...

2008-07-15 11:16:00 127

extremeComponents使用AJAX 指南

AJAX 指南在eXtremeTable中使用AJAX非常简单,对现有功能的扩展也非常方便。 AJAX整合一个最强大的地方是它不需要整合。你可以自由地使用任何你想要使用的AJAX工具包。所有你要做的就是:当表的action被调用时,告诉 eXtremeTable使用什么javascript。表的actions包括:过滤、排序、分页、显示的行数和导出。 在我自己的示例中我将使用非常酷...

2008-07-15 10:45:00 97

Java中3DES加密解密调用示例

在java中调用sun公司提供的3DES加密解密算法时,需要使用到$JAVA_HOME/jre/lib/目录下如下的4个jar包:jce.jarsecurity/US_export_policy.jarsecurity/local_policy.jarext/sunjce_provider.jar Java运行时会自动加载这些包,因此对于带main函数的应用程序不需要设置到CLASSPA...

2008-07-15 10:34:00 141

Spring 2.0 AOP 与事务配置突破

Spring 2.0 的重头戏之一就是AspectJ 式 AOP 配置。 但是一定要通过对比,才能看到2.0式的AOP配置是如何跳出一片新天空的。 1. 对比先看1.0的标准事务配置:<bean id="baseTxService" class="org.springframework.transaction.interceptor.TransactionProxyFact...

2008-07-15 10:26:00 74

Sybase Workspace 中文显示设置

数据库SYBASE连接的时候,选择JDBC连接,然后在字符串后加字符集为CP936,如下示: jdbc:sybase:Tds:FENGLB:5000/IMPS?charset=cp936这样就可以正常显示中文,如用CP850就不行。...

2008-07-01 14:11:25 291

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除